贝克休斯在佛罗伦萨举行的年会上推出自主油井建造解决方案

能源技术公司贝克休斯宣布推出Kantori®自主油井建造解决方案,这是一项全新的统一数字化服务,可在油井建造过程的每个阶段提供智能操作和精简的工作流程。Kantori在贝克休斯于意大利佛罗伦萨举行的第26届年会上正式发布。

Kantori 将人工智能和基于物理的模型与实时数据分析相结合,持续优化性能,并实现规划、执行和监控活动的自动化。这种方法支持快速决策,最大限度地减少人为干预,从而减少油井建造作业中的非生产性时间和变异性。

“自主钻井为我们行业开辟了新的天地,用能够实时学习、适应和优化性能的智能系统取代了被动作业,”贝克休斯油田服务与设备执行副总裁阿梅里诺·加蒂表示。“这种基于数十年钻井经验和智能工程技术的数字化驱动方法,使油井建造更加智能、安全和可预测。贝克休斯在该领域树立了标杆,而Kantori标志着油井建造数字化创新的新篇章。”

Kantori 支持油井建造的整个生命周期,涵盖连接和数据集成、油井规划和性能优化。该解决方案采用可扩展设计,能够根据客户需求进行调整,无论是单井还是整个油田。Corva 提供实时分析和预测智能,并与 Kantori 无缝集成,从而增强了灵活性和控制力。

Kantori是贝克休斯端到端数字化解决方案组合的一部分,与Leucipa 自动化现场生产解决方案和Cordant 资产绩效管理软件共同构成该组合。贝克休斯拥有百年能源创新传承,致力于将Kantori等数字化解决方案与公司成熟的技术相结合,帮助客户提高效率、延长资产寿命并实现收益最大化。点击此处了解更多关于公司端到端数字化解决方案组合的信息。Kantori现已在全球范围内推出,具体条款和条件以适用法律法规为准。

Baker Hughes launches autonomous well construction solution at Annual Meeting in Florence

Baker Hughes, an energy technology company, has announced the launch of the Kantori™ autonomous well construction solution, a new unified digital service that provides intelligent operations and streamlined workflows across every stage of the well construction process. Kantori was unveiled at Baker Hughes’ 26th Annual Meeting in Florence, Italy.

Kantori combines artificial intelligence and physics-based models with real-time data analytics to continually optimise performance and enable automation across planning, execution and monitoring activities. This approach supports rapid decision making with limited human intervention, reducing nonproductive time and variability during well construction operations.

“Autonomous drilling has opened new frontiers for our industry, replacing reactive operations with intelligent systems that can learn, adapt and optimise performance in real time,” said Amerino Gatti, executive vice president, Oilfield Services & Equipment at Baker Hughes. “This digitally driven approach, built on decades of drilling expertise and intelligent engineering, is making well construction smarter, safer and more predictable. Baker Hughes has set the standard in this field, and Kantori marks the next chapter of digital innovation in well construction.”

Kantori supports the entire well construction life cycle, from connectivity and data integration to well planning and performance optimisation. The solution is scalable by design and adapts to customer needs, whether for a single well or across an entire field. Corva, which provides real-time analytics and predictive intelligence, is seamlessly integrated with Kantori for enhanced flexibility and control.

Kantori is part of Baker Hughes’ end-to-end portfolio of digital solutions, joining LeucipaTM automated field production solution and CordantTM Asset Performance Management software. With a 100 year heritage of energy innovation, Baker Hughes is integrating digital solutions such as Kantori with the company’s proven technologies to help customers achieve greater efficiency, extend asset life, and maximise returns.
